Steven Dake wrote:
> On Mon, 2008-04-28 at 11:05 +0100, Christine Caulfield wrote:
>> This is a patch that adds some standalone code to libconfdb, so it can
>> examine and ultimately change, the configuration without aisexec running.
>>
>> A small number of things I'm unsure about..
>>
>> - it automatically falls back to standalone if it can't connect to
>> aisexec. That might not be the right thing to do, opinions welcome.
>
>
Revised patch attached
> standalone mode should only be used when the environment variable for
> the configuration engine is set. If it isn't set, then it should return
> an error standard for aisexec not running.
>
>> - any program accessing confdb needs to be linked -rdynamic so that
>> several objdb/config symbols can be resolved. There might be ways around
>> this though I'm not sure how nice they are!
>
> Yikes
Looking at it, I can't see any reasonable way round this. The lcrso
system requires that the registration code for the lcrso is accessible
from the loading program.
Without -rdynamic, a program using libconfdb will give the following
error when stanadalone access is requested:
/usr/libexec/lcrso/aisparser.lcrso: open failed:
/usr/libexec/lcrso/aisparser.lcrso: undefined symbol: lcr_component_register
Normal access via aisexec doesn't need it though.
>> - Some config options I haven't got to work yet. In particular the new
>> cman preconfig module calls logsys, and I'm undecided about the best way
>> to tackle this. I think maybe the callers ought also to link with
>> logsys, but a quite test seems to make this difficult for some reason.
>>
>>
>
> The configuration engine plugins shouldn't be dependent upon logsys or
> any other third party library.
OK, so the cman ones need logsys ripping ouy and replacing with syslog
... there's progress ;-)
Chrissie

+/*
+ * Provides stand-alone access to data in the openais object database
+ * when aisexec is not running.
+ */
+
+#include <stdlib.h>
+#include <string.h>
+#include <unistd.h>
+#include <pthread.h>
+#include <sys/types.h>
+#include <errno.h>
+
+#include <saAis.h>
+#include <ais_util.h>
+#include "../exec/objdb.h"
+#include "../exec/config.h"
+#include "../lcr/lcr_comp.h"
+#include "../lcr/lcr_ifact.h"
+#include "../exec/logsys.h"
+
+static struct objdb_iface_ver0 *objdb;
+
+static int num_config_modules;
+
+static struct config_iface_ver0 *config_modules[128];
+
+
+static int load_objdb()
+{
+ unsigned int objdb_handle;
+ void *objdb_p;
+ int res;
+
+ /*
+ * Load the object database interface
+ */
+ res = lcr_ifact_reference (
+ &objdb_handle,
+ "objdb",
+ 0,
+ &objdb_p,
+ 0);
+ if (res == -1) {
+ return -1;
+ }
+
+ objdb = (struct objdb_iface_ver0 *)objdb_p;
+
+ objdb->objdb_init ();
+ return SA_AIS_OK;
+}
+
+static int load_config()
+{
+ char *config_iface;
+ char *iface;
+ int res;
+ unsigned int config_handle;
+ unsigned int config_version = 0;
+ void *config_p;
+ struct config_iface_ver0 *config;
+ char *error_string;
+
+ /* User's bootstrap config service */
+ config_iface = getenv("OPENAIS_DEFAULT_CONFIG_IFACE");
+ if (!config_iface) {
+ config_iface = "aisparser";
+ }
+
+ /* Make a copy so we can deface it with strtok */
+ config_iface = strdup(config_iface);
+
+ iface = strtok(config_iface, ":");
+ while (iface)
+ {
+ res = lcr_ifact_reference (
+ &config_handle,
+ iface,
+ config_version,
+ &config_p,
+ 0);
+
+ config = (struct config_iface_ver0 *)config_p;
+ if (res == -1) {
+ return -1;
+ }
+
+ res = config->config_readconfig(objdb, &error_string);
+ if (res == -1) {
+ return -1;
+ }
+
+ config_modules[num_config_modules++] = config;
+
+ iface = strtok(NULL, ":");
+ }
+ if (config_iface)
+ free(config_iface);
+
+ return SA_AIS_OK;
+}
+
+/* Needed by objdb when it writes back the configuration */
+void main_get_config_modules(struct config_iface_ver0 ***modules, int *num)
+{
+ *modules = config_modules;
+ *num = num_config_modules;
+}
+
+/* Needed by some modules ... */
+char *strstr_rs (const char *haystack, const char *needle)
+{
+ char *end_address;
+ char *new_needle;
+
+ new_needle = (char *)strdup (needle);
+ new_needle[strlen (new_needle) - 1] = '\0';
+
+ end_address = strstr (haystack, new_needle);
+ if (end_address) {
+ end_address += strlen (new_needle);
+ end_address = strstr (end_address, needle + strlen (new_needle));
+ }
+ if (end_address) {
+ end_address += 1; /* skip past { or = */
+ do {
+ if (*end_address == '\t' || *end_address == ' ') {
+ end_address++;
+ } else {
+ break;
+ }
+ } while (*end_address != '\0');
+ }
+
+ free (new_needle);
+ return (end_address);
+}
+
+int confdb_sa_init (void)
+{
+ int res;
+
+ res = load_objdb();
+ if (res != SA_AIS_OK)
+ return res;
+
+ res = load_config();
+
+ return res;
+}
